Understanding Focused Shockwave Therapy (F-SWT)
Focused Shockwave Therapy uses precisely targeted acoustic energy to reach deeper layers of soft tissue that manual techniques or surface treatments cannot effectively reach. Unlike general or superficial therapies, F-SWT concentrates high-energy sound waves on specific problem areas beneath the skin to stimulate healing and tissue regeneration.
The energy pulses from F-SWT create controlled micro-trauma within the affected area, which encourages the body’s natural repair processes. This technology is particularly effective for treating musculoskeletal injuries, tendon and ligament conditions, and chronic pain that have not improved with other therapies.

How Focused Shockwave Therapy Works: The Science Behind Healing

The effectiveness of F-SWT comes from a biological process called mechanotransduction, where mechanical energy is converted into cellular and chemical activity that promotes healing. When the acoustic waves penetrate deep tissue, several beneficial reactions occur:
- Improved blood circulation through angiogenesis (formation of new blood vessels), bringing oxygen and nutrients to damaged tissues.
- Stimulation of collagen synthesis, strengthening tendons, ligaments, and connective tissues.
- Reduction of pain through decreased transmission of pain signals and desensitization of nerve endings.
- Release of nitric oxide, which supports anti-inflammatory and regenerative effects.

Focused Shockwave vs Radial Shockwave Therapy
Although both therapies use acoustic energy, Focused Shockwave Therapy (F-SWT) and Radial Shockwave Therapy (R-SWT) differ in how they deliver it. F-SWT directs energy to a precise focal point deep within the body, making it ideal for chronic, hard-to-reach injuries. R-SWT spreads energy over a broader surface area, which works best for superficial pain or general muscle tightness.

Patients with deep tendon or ligament injuries, stress fractures, or calcific deposits typically respond better to Focused Shockwave Therapy, while those with myofascial pain or superficial soft tissue issues may benefit more from Radial Pressure Wave therapy.

What to Expect During Your Treatment at OPTCI

Your first visit at Osteopractic Physical Therapy of Central Indiana begins with a detailed consultation and physical examination. The therapist may use palpation or ultrasound imaging to locate the target tissue precisely. A specialized coupling gel is applied to ensure effective energy transmission, and a handheld applicator delivers rapid, high-intensity pulses to the area.
Each session typically lasts around 15–20 minutes. Most patients report feeling mild tapping sensations rather than pain. Depending on the condition, a treatment plan may include three to five sessions spaced one week apart.
After the session, you can return to daily activities immediately. Some may experience slight tenderness, which usually resolves within 24 hours. Your therapist may recommend complementary care, such as manual therapy or targeted rehabilitation exercises, to improve long-term outcomes.
